Biography
My greatest area of clinical interest and skill centers around self-regulation, or "how we manage" our thoughts, feelings, emotions, behaviors, etc. I appreciate the challenges related to anxiety, stress, depression, substance use, and trauma, and I employ various tools to help folks manage (e.g., cognitive behavioral therapy, psychodynamic therapy, humanism, mindfulness/somatic psychology, etc.).
I am a Licensed Professional Counselor with broad and varied professional work experience in behavioral health (inpatient and outpatient, individuals and families, children and adults, direct service and program administration). I earned my B.A. in Psychology at Gannon University and my M.A. in Clinical Psychology at Edinboro University of Pennsylvania. I've also earned a Post-Master's Certificate in General Psychology from Northcentral University and have completed many doctorate credits in Psychology. Since 1999, I have taught university courses in Psychology, Sociology, and Human Services, most recently at Gannon University and Penn State University.
